640d3f1f35
- regen PLIST ok landry@
51 lines
1.1 KiB
Makefile
51 lines
1.1 KiB
Makefile
# $OpenBSD: Makefile,v 1.17 2010/11/21 11:39:14 benoit Exp $
|
|
|
|
COMMENT = Atari 2600 VCS emulator
|
|
|
|
DISTNAME = stella-3.3
|
|
CATEGORIES = emulators
|
|
DISTFILES = ${DISTNAME}-src.tar.gz
|
|
|
|
HOMEPAGE = http://stella.sourceforge.net/
|
|
|
|
MAINTAINER = Benoit Lecocq <benoit@openbsd.org>
|
|
|
|
# GPLv2
|
|
PERMIT_PACKAGE_CDROM = Yes
|
|
PERMIT_PACKAGE_FTP = Yes
|
|
PERMIT_DISTFILES_CDROM =Yes
|
|
PERMIT_DISTFILES_FTP = Yes
|
|
|
|
WANTLIB = c stdc++ m z pthread SDL>=1.2 png
|
|
|
|
MASTER_SITES = ${MASTER_SITE_SOURCEFORGE:=stella/}
|
|
|
|
LIB_DEPENDS = devel/sdl \
|
|
graphics/png
|
|
|
|
CXXFLAGS += -I${LOCALBASE}/include/libpng \
|
|
-I${X11BASE}/include \
|
|
-L${LOCALBASE}/lib
|
|
CONFIGURE_STYLE = simple
|
|
CONFIGURE_ARGS += --disable-gl
|
|
|
|
USE_GMAKE = Yes
|
|
|
|
NO_REGRESS = Yes
|
|
|
|
DOCSBASE = ${WRKDIST}/docs
|
|
HTMLDOCS = ${DOCSBASE}/*.html
|
|
HTMLGRAPHICS = ${DOCSBASE}/graphics/*.png
|
|
DOCSDIR = ${PREFIX}/share/doc/stella
|
|
|
|
do-install:
|
|
${INSTALL_PROGRAM} ${WRKDIST}/stella ${PREFIX}/bin
|
|
|
|
post-install:
|
|
${INSTALL_DATA_DIR} ${DOCSDIR}
|
|
${INSTALL_DATA} ${HTMLDOCS} ${DOCSDIR}
|
|
${INSTALL_DATA_DIR} ${DOCSDIR}/graphics
|
|
${INSTALL_DATA} ${HTMLGRAPHICS} ${DOCSDIR}/graphics/
|
|
|
|
.include <bsd.port.mk>
|